Fright Fest FAQs
Fright Fest Admission
Fright Fest park admission is included with a Season Pass or Single Day Ticket (unless otherwise stated). This includes the theme park rides, Fun By Day activities, TERRORtories and live shows. Haunted Houses are an additional charge.
Booville Hours
Booville is open on Saturdays and Sundays only, as well as Monday, October 12. This area does NOT open on Friday nights. KiddieLand/Booville will close at dusk each evening.
No-Scare Wristband
Guests who do not want to be scared can visit Guest Relations to purchase a No-Scare Wristband. This does not guarantee a scare-free evening. Our monsters will do their best to avoid you but some initial contact may occur.
Park Entry and Re-Entry
No park entry after 9:00pm. No park re-entry after 6:00pm.
Costume Policy
Costumes and partial makeup are permitted but some items (such as capes) may be restricted on certain rides for safety purposes.
Masks or costumes that cover the entire face are NOT permitted on guests over 10 years of age.
Weapons of any kind – whether real or plastic – are NOT permitted in the park.
Any costumes deemed to be excessively offensive or obscene will need to be removed or covered.
Code of Conduct Policy
- NO running in the park.
- NO use of profanity.
- NO horseplay/fighting.
- NO mistreating our monsters.
- NO line jumping.
All park rules and regulations will be enfoced just like any other day at our park. Any violation of these rules will not be tolerated. Guests who do so can be ejected from the park without compensation for their tickets/passes.
